    Single Barrel and Bottled in Bond Bourbons!
    James C.

    We discovered this place recently online and realized it's only 45 minutes from home. On our way home from Illinois for the 40 reunion of the class of 1981 of Dwight Township High School we decided to stop and check them out. We immediately met Ashley and she started describing the different spirits from the "Corn liquor", to the "Single Barrel Bourbon", and the "Bottled in Bond Bourbon"! I purchased the two I've just mentioned and can't wait to enjoy them! Update! I tried both of these fine spirits and I must say they're very nice! The three year is everything I'd expect and the four year is even better!
